Output 27883c80302c91c991f4683dfc0d9cafdac539259b6a98a08a2ac6ae82311317:9

value
19265197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728be0a6caedff496ea866e268170be27213f353 OP_EQUAL
address
MJLpqAJ6De5aXrK6hruJrVswmdmiPkkCmc
transaction
27883c80302c91c991f4683dfc0d9cafdac539259b6a98a08a2ac6ae82311317
spent
true